Definitions of cephalate word
- adjective cephalate (of living organisms) possessing a head or headlike feature 3
- adjective cephalate having a head or headlike part. 1
- noun cephalate (zoology) Having a head. 1

Origin of cephalate
First appearance:
before 1860 One of the 29% newest English words
First recorded in 1860-65; cephal- + -ate1
